The Role of a Psychiatrist in Mental Health Care

What Does a Psychiatrist Do?

Psychiatrists are medical doctors who specialize in diagnosing, treating, and preventing mental health disorders. Unlike psychologists or counselors, a Psychiatrist in Lucknow has the authority to prescribe medications, order medical tests, and integrate physical and psychological evaluations. They address conditions such as depression, anxiety, schizophrenia, bipolar disorder, and more, tailoring treatments to individual needs.

How Is a Psychiatrist Different from Other Mental Health Professionals?

While psychologists focus on therapy and behavioral interventions, a Psychiatrist in Lucknow combines medical expertise with psychological insights. They can diagnose underlying medical conditions that contribute to mental health issues, such as thyroid disorders or neurological problems. This dual expertise makes psychiatrists uniquely equipped to provide comprehensive care, often collaborating with therapists for holistic treatment plans.

The Psychiatric Process: How Psychiatrists Work

Step 1: Initial Consultation and History-Taking

The journey with a Psychiatrist in Lucknow begins with an in-depth consultation. During this session, the psychiatrist gathers detailed information about the patient’s medical history, lifestyle, and current symptoms. For example, they may ask about sleep patterns, appetite changes, or emotional triggers. For children, parents or guardians provide additional context, while adults share challenges in relationships, work, or daily functioning.

This step is crucial for building a complete picture of the patient’s mental and physical health.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ow listens attentively, creating a safe space for patients to express concerns without judgment. The consultation often lasts 45–60 minutes, allowing ample time to explore the patient’s background.

Step 2: Diagnostic Assessment

Once the history is gathered, a Psychiatrist in Lucknow conducts a diagnostic assessment. This involves evaluating symptoms against standardized criteria, such as those in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5). For instance, to diagnose depression, they assess symptoms like persistent sadness, loss of interest, or fatigue over a specific period.

Psychiatrists may use structured interviews, questionnaires, or rating scales to ensure accuracy.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ow also considers cultural nuances, as expressions of mental distress can vary across communities. For example, anxiety may manifest as physical complaints like headaches in some patients, which requires careful evaluation.

Step 3: Ruling Out Medical Causes

Mental health symptoms can sometimes stem from physical conditions.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ow is trained to identify these underlying issues through medical evaluations. For example, symptoms of anxiety could be linked to hyperthyroidism, or memory problems might indicate a vitamin deficiency. In such cases, the psychiatrist may order blood tests, imaging studies, or referrals to specialists to rule out medical causes.

This step ensures that the diagnosis is precise and that treatment addresses the root cause. By combining medical and psychological expertise, a Psychiatrist in Lucknow provides a level of care that non-medical professionals cannot.

Step 4: Creating a Treatment Plan

After confirming a diagnosis, a Psychiatrist in Lucknow develops a personalized treatment plan. This may include:

  • Medication: For conditions like depression or schizophrenia, medications such as antidepressants or antipsychotics may be prescribed.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ow carefully selects medications based on the patient’s symptoms, medical history, and potential side effects.
  • Psychotherapy: Many psychiatrists offer therapy or collaborate with psychologists for c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), or other modalities.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ow may recommend therapy to address thought patterns, coping skills, or emotional regulation.
  • Lifestyle Changes: Diet, exercise, and sleep hygiene play a significant role in mental health.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ow may suggest mindfulness practices, stress management techniques, or routine adjustments to support recovery.
  • Follow-Up Care: Mental health treatment is ongoing.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ow schedules regular follow-ups to monitor progress, adjust medications, or refine therapy goals.

The treatment plan is tailored to the patient’s needs, preferences, and cultural context, ensuring it is both effective and sustainable.

Challenges in Psychiatric Care

Diagnosing mental health conditions can be complex due to overlapping symptoms and comorbidities. For example, anxiety and depression often coexist, requiring careful assessment. A Psychiatrist in Lucknow mitigates these challenges by using evidence-based tools and maintaining a patient-centered approach. Access to care can also be a barrier in rural areas, but many psychiatrists in Lucknow now offer teleconsultations to bridge this gap.
